Are there any special discounts for young drivers in tennessee?

Young drivers with a “B” average or higher are entitled to discounts. Based on usage, some insurance companies offer discounts for. Qualify for a discount if all drivers of your vehicle under 21 complete an approved driver education course. Teen drivers with good grades or test scores can get discounts on car insurance, but they vary by company.

Some of the discounts can last for years. Just about anyone can get a discount on car insurance in Tennessee because most insurance companies make it easy to get a variety of savings. You can get discounts on car insurance in Tennessee depending on how you drive, the car you own, and your relationship with your insurance company. Penalties for driving without insurance in Tennessee include fines and the suspension of the driver's license and registration.

Under Tennessee law, the minimum requirements for state auto insurance include bodily injury liability insurance, which pays for the medical expenses of the driver who is not at fault and that of his passengers, and property damage liability coverage, which pays for repairs to the vehicle of the driver who is not at fault.
